Excerpt from The Busy Life of Eighty-Five Years of Ezra Meeker: Ventures and Adventures
Just why I should write a preface I know not, except that it is fashionable to do so, and yet in the present case there would seem a little explanation due the reader, who may cast his eye on the first chapter of this work.
Indeed, the chapter, Early Days in Indiana, may properly be termed an introduction, though quite inti mately connected with the narrative that follows, yet not necessary to make a completed story of the trip to Oregon in the early fifties.
